EliSophie Andrée, born 1996, is a playwright,
Children's and young adult book author, screenwriter and director.

EliSophie is educated at Stockholm University of Dramatic Arts, Bachelor of Screenwriting 2018 - 2021. Despite her young age, she has achieved several great successes in several different mediums.

In 2017, her debut book MY NAME IS was released, which was praised by critics and readers. Just a month after graduating from STDH, the traveling theater MISSING ALICE had its premiere and then played a completely sold-out run in the summer of 2021. Sold-out runs are also a recurring theme that can be seen in the critically acclaimed plays 5 MINUTER (2022) and SKJORTKRAVALLERNA (2023). In addition to performing arts, EliSophie also works in film and television. In the spring of 2023, the TV series INGEN ÄNGEL came to Viaplay, where EliSophie was both creator and main writer. INGEN ÄNGEL was also nominated for the Kristallen for best young drama series.

EliSophie is also behind the easy-to-read, popular and critically acclaimed book series GIRL GANG, published by Hegas Publishing.

EliSophie's work often leans towards the comic side with a lot of blackness. She is inspired by Baz Luhrmann, Taylor Swift and William Shakespeare in her work. Nominations and awards

Recipient of the Helsingborg Cultural Scholarship 2017

Nominated Pixel Talent Award 2022

Nominated 1 KM Film Stockholm Film Festival 2022

Recipient of the Skåne Savings Bank Foundation Film Scholarship 2022

Kristallen nominated for best youth series 2023

Recipient of the Anders Sandrews Foundation Screenwriting Scholarship 2024
